Gingival hyperpigmentation, characterized by darkening of the gums, can stem from various factors. These include genetic predispositions, medication side effects (such as minocycline), smoking, systemic diseases like Addison’s disease, or even amalgam tattoos caused by dental fillings. The appearance can range from isolated spots to complete coloration of the gingival tissue.

1. Diagnosis
Accurate diagnosis forms the cornerstone of effectively addressing gingival hyperpigmentation. The clinical appearance of darkened gums may arise from diverse etiologies, necessitating a thorough investigation to determine the precise underlying cause. A misdiagnosis could lead to inappropriate treatment strategies and failure to resolve the aesthetic concern, potentially exacerbating the condition or causing unnecessary complications. For example, if the pigmentation stems from a systemic condition like Addison’s disease, treatment should focus on managing the underlying systemic issue rather than solely addressing the gingival appearance.
The diagnostic process typically involves a comprehensive medical and dental history, a detailed clinical examination of the oral cavity, and potentially radiographic imaging or biopsies. The clinician will assess the extent and pattern of pigmentation, noting any associated symptoms such as inflammation or bleeding. Differential diagnosis may include physiologic pigmentation (common in individuals with darker skin tones), drug-induced pigmentation, smoker’s melanosis, or even rare instances of malignant melanoma. An incisional biopsy followed by histopathological examination is critical when the etiology is unclear or malignancy is suspected.

2. Cause Identification
Pinpointing the etiology of gingival hyperpigmentation is paramount to determining appropriate intervention strategies. The effectiveness of any attempt to lighten darkened gums hinges directly on understanding the underlying cause. If the discoloration is due to tobacco use, cessation is a necessary first step, without which any cosmetic procedures will likely prove futile. Similarly, if certain medications are implicated, consulting with the prescribing physician about alternative options is crucial before considering dental treatments. Failing to identify and address the root cause risks recurrence of the pigmentation, rendering subsequent treatments less effective or requiring repeated interventions.
Consider, for example, the scenario of amalgam tattoos. These occur when small particles of amalgam from dental fillings become embedded in the gingival tissue. In such cases, laser treatment or chemical peels, designed to address melanin-related pigmentation, would be ineffective. Surgical removal of the affected tissue is typically the only reliable method. Another common cause is physiologic pigmentation, particularly prevalent in individuals with darker skin tones. While aesthetic treatments can lighten the gums, it is essential to manage patient expectations, as complete elimination of pigmentation may not be achievable or sustainable. Aggressive treatments in these cases could even lead to unwanted side effects such as scarring.

3. Treatment Options
Addressing gingival hyperpigmentation involves a variety of therapeutic interventions aimed at reducing or eliminating the darkened appearance of the gums. The choice of treatment is contingent on the underlying cause of the pigmentation, the extent of involvement, and the patient’s individual preferences and medical history. A careful assessment is essential to ensure the selected method is appropriate and effective for the specific situation.
-
Surgical Excision
Surgical removal of the affected gingival tissue represents a traditional approach. The procedure involves physically cutting away the pigmented layer, typically using a scalpel. This method is particularly useful for localized areas of pigmentation or when dealing with amalgam tattoos. However, surgical excision may result in postoperative discomfort and requires meticulous wound care. Inadequate technique can lead to scarring or uneven gum contours, potentially compromising aesthetic outcomes. The excised tissue is often sent for histopathological examination to confirm the diagnosis and rule out any underlying pathology.
-
Laser Ablation
Laser therapy utilizes focused beams of light to selectively remove the pigmented cells. This technique offers several advantages over surgical excision, including reduced bleeding, minimal swelling, and often faster healing times. Various types of lasers, such as diode lasers and CO2 lasers, can be employed. Laser ablation is effective for treating diffuse pigmentation affecting larger areas of the gums. The procedure is generally well-tolerated, although multiple sessions may be required to achieve the desired aesthetic result. The precision of laser technology allows for controlled removal of pigmented tissue, minimizing damage to surrounding healthy gingiva.
-
Cryosurgery
Cryosurgery involves the application of extreme cold to freeze and destroy the pigmented tissue. This technique utilizes substances such as liquid nitrogen to induce cell death in the targeted area. Cryosurgery is a relatively simple and cost-effective method, but it may be associated with prolonged healing times and a higher risk of postoperative complications, such as blistering and discomfort. The depth of tissue destruction can be challenging to control precisely, potentially leading to unpredictable aesthetic outcomes. While cryosurgery can be effective for certain types of gingival pigmentation, it is not as widely used as surgical excision or laser ablation due to its potential drawbacks.
-
Chemical Peels
Chemical peels involve the application of chemical agents, such as trichloroacetic acid (TCA), to the gingival surface to induce controlled chemical destruction of the pigmented layer. This technique is less invasive than surgical excision but requires careful application to avoid damaging the underlying tissues. The depth of penetration of the chemical agent must be carefully controlled to achieve the desired effect without causing excessive inflammation or scarring. Chemical peels may be suitable for superficial pigmentation but are generally less effective for deeper pigmentation. Multiple sessions are often required to achieve the desired aesthetic outcome.

4. Procedure Selection
The process of selecting an appropriate procedure is a pivotal determinant in achieving successful resolution of gingival hyperpigmentation. The effectiveness of any intervention hinges on the precise match between the chosen technique and the underlying etiology of the discoloration. For instance, employing laser ablation to address pigmentation stemming from amalgam tattoos would be inherently ineffective, as the laser targets melanin and not the embedded metallic particles. Conversely, surgical excision may be overly aggressive for superficial pigmentation that could be adequately managed with chemical peels. Thus, meticulous consideration of the causative factors is essential to guide the selection process and avoid futile or even detrimental interventions.
The selection of a procedure also necessitates careful consideration of patient-specific factors. Medical history, particularly conditions affecting wound healing or immune response, can significantly influence the choice. A patient with a bleeding disorder, for example, may be a less suitable candidate for surgical excision, while laser therapy, with its hemostatic properties, could be a more appropriate option. Furthermore, patient preferences regarding recovery time, potential discomfort, and cost should be factored into the decision-making process. A thorough discussion of the advantages, disadvantages, and potential risks associated with each technique is crucial to ensure informed consent and realistic expectations.

5. Gingival Health
The state of gingival health is inextricably linked to the aesthetic concern of darkened gums. While eliminating pigmentation addresses the visual aspect, compromised gingival health can exacerbate or even be the primary cause of the discoloration. Therefore, attaining and maintaining healthy gums is often a prerequisite for, or an essential component of, any successful depigmentation strategy.
-
Inflammation and Pigmentation
Chronic inflammation of the gums, often resulting from poor oral hygiene or periodontal disease, can stimulate melanocyte activity, leading to increased melanin production and subsequent darkening of the gingival tissue. Addressing the underlying inflammation through scaling, root planing, and improved oral hygiene practices is crucial for preventing further pigmentation and promoting a healthier gingival appearance. For example, smokers often experience both inflammation and increased melanin production, compounding the discoloration.
-
Periodontal Disease and Treatment Outcomes
The presence of periodontal disease can significantly impact the success of depigmentation procedures. Inflamed and diseased gums may not respond predictably to treatments like laser ablation or surgical excision. Moreover, the compromised tissue integrity increases the risk of complications, such as infection and delayed healing. Therefore, achieving periodontal stability through appropriate treatment modalities is paramount before considering any aesthetic interventions. This might involve antibiotic therapy, surgical correction of periodontal defects, or meticulous plaque control.
-
Oral Hygiene and Maintenance
Maintaining excellent oral hygiene is fundamental for preventing the recurrence of gingival hyperpigmentation after treatment. Inadequate plaque control can lead to gingival inflammation, stimulating melanocyte activity and reversing the aesthetic gains achieved through depigmentation procedures. Regular brushing, flossing, and professional dental cleanings are essential for minimizing inflammation and preserving a healthy gingival appearance. Patients should be educated on proper oral hygiene techniques and the importance of consistent adherence to these practices.
-
Systemic Health Considerations
Systemic conditions such as Addison’s disease and certain medications can contribute to gingival hyperpigmentation. In such cases, addressing the underlying systemic issue or modifying medication regimens is essential for managing the discoloration. Patients with systemic conditions require close collaboration between their dentist and physician to ensure a comprehensive and coordinated approach to treatment. Focusing solely on local depigmentation procedures without addressing the systemic factors may result in only temporary improvement.

8. Prevention
Prevention represents a proactive approach to mitigating gingival hyperpigmentation, minimizing the need for interventional treatments. Focusing on preventative strategies can significantly reduce the likelihood of developing darkened gums, thereby preserving the natural aesthetics of the gingiva and potentially avoiding more invasive procedures.
-
Smoking Cessation
Tobacco use is a well-established contributor to gingival melanosis. The chemicals in tobacco smoke stimulate melanocytes, leading to increased melanin production and subsequent darkening of the gums. Smoking cessation is paramount for preventing this type of pigmentation. Individuals who quit smoking often experience a gradual lightening of their gums over time, as the melanocyte activity returns to normal. Public health campaigns and smoking cessation programs can play a crucial role in promoting this preventative measure.
-
Medication Awareness
Certain medications, such as minocycline and some antimalarials, are known to cause gingival pigmentation as a side effect. Awareness of these potential side effects and open communication with prescribing physicians can help individuals make informed decisions about their medication regimens. In some cases, alternative medications that do not cause pigmentation may be available. If not, diligent oral hygiene and regular dental check-ups are essential for monitoring and managing any developing pigmentation.
-
Amalgam Tattoo Mitigation
Amalgam tattoos result from the accidental implantation of amalgam particles into the gingival tissue during dental procedures. Careful dental techniques, such as using rubber dams and proper suction, can minimize the risk of amalgam tattoos. If amalgam particles are inadvertently implanted, prompt removal can prevent the development of a permanent dark spot on the gums. Patient education regarding the potential for amalgam tattoos and the importance of reporting any unusual discoloration is also crucial.
-
Optimal Oral Hygiene
Maintaining excellent oral hygiene is fundamental for preventing gingival inflammation, which can contribute to hyperpigmentation. Regular brushing, flossing, and professional dental cleanings remove plaque and calculus, reducing the risk of gingivitis and periodontitis. Consistent oral hygiene practices also help prevent the development of other oral health problems, further supporting overall gingival health and aesthetic appearance. Emphasis should be given to proper brushing techniques and the use of appropriate oral hygiene aids.

Frequently Asked Questions
The following addresses common inquiries regarding the causes, treatment, and prevention of darkened gums. The information provided aims to offer clarity and guidance on managing this aesthetic concern.
Question 1: What are the primary causes of gingival hyperpigmentation?
Gingival hyperpigmentation arises from various factors. These include genetic predisposition, excessive melanin production, smoking, certain medications (e.g., minocycline), systemic diseases (e.g., Addison’s disease), and amalgam tattoos from dental fillings.
Question 2: Is gingival hyperpigmentation a sign of a serious medical condition?
While often a cosmetic concern, gingival hyperpigmentation can sometimes indicate an underlying medical condition. Systemic diseases like Addison’s disease and Peutz-Jeghers syndrome can manifest as gum discoloration. It is crucial to consult with a healthcare professional for proper diagnosis.
Question 3: Can over-the-counter products lighten darkened gums?
Currently, no over-the-counter products are proven safe and effective for lightening darkened gums. Attempting to use such products without professional guidance can be harmful. Consult a qualified dental professional for appropriate treatment options.
Question 4: What professional treatments are available for gingival depigmentation?
Professional treatment options include surgical excision, laser ablation, cryosurgery, and chemical peels. The choice of treatment depends on the cause and extent of the pigmentation, as well as the patient’s individual needs and preferences.
Question 5: Is gingival depigmentation a permanent solution?
The longevity of gingival depigmentation varies. While initial treatments can effectively lighten the gums, recurrence is possible, especially if the underlying cause is not addressed or if preventative measures are not followed. Maintaining excellent oral hygiene and addressing causative factors like smoking are critical.
Question 6: How can gingival hyperpigmentation be prevented?
Prevention strategies include smoking cessation, awareness of medication side effects, meticulous oral hygiene practices, and careful dental procedures to avoid amalgam tattoos. Regular dental check-ups are also essential for early detection and management.
